At a high school, students can choose between three art electives, four history electives, and five computer electives. Each stu

dent can choose two electives. Which expression represents the probability that a student chooses an art elective and a history elective?

Answer:

\frac{^3C_1\times ^4C_1}{^{12}C_2}

Step-by-step explanation:

Given,

Art electives = 3,

History electives = 4,

Computer electives = 5,

Total number of electives = 3 + 4 + 5 = 12,

Since, if a student chooses an art elective and a history elective,

So, the total combination of choosing an art elective and a history elective = ^3C_1\times ^4C_1

Also, the total combination of choosing any 2 subjects out of 12 subjects = ^{12}C_2

Hence, the probability that a student chooses an art elective and a history elective = \frac{\text{Total combination of choosing an art elective and a history}}{\text{ Total combination of choosing any 2 subjects}}

=\frac{^3C_1\times ^4C_1}{^{12}C_2}

Which is the required expression.
